Output 3d1835ef6883a065e20e8a4932aa529f162c69ce2ce23de72d517fc8bc754bcd:13

value
59750
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ff00cf434187619e56fec67307fbe42a0525edc8 OP_EQUAL
address
3QwMCiMnzManDDzY4B5HD7zA7pWAAzmy6r
transaction
3d1835ef6883a065e20e8a4932aa529f162c69ce2ce23de72d517fc8bc754bcd
spent
true